Job Summary:

The Artificial Intelligence Analyst will play a pivotal role in harnessing advanced data science to drive the development of AI solutions across the SUNY Upstate Medical University.

This position involves collaborating with multiple teams to review external AI solutions, develop in-house tools, and implement, optimize, and closely monitor the product's life cycle.

This role will work closely with the AI Governance Lead to ensure implementation aligns with the university's mission, vision, and values, as well as all relevant laws and regulations.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Engage with teams throughout the university to evaluate and implement AI and automation solutions
  • Lead the development of in-house AI and machine learning
  • Identify trustworthy AI and automation solutions to recommend best practices in process improvement
  • Stay up-to-date with emerging regulatory guidelines to ensure compliance and address potential gaps
  • Work closely with leadership to ensure project objectives align with organizational goals
  • Create and maintain documentation toward explainable AI (XAI) to develop models that are transparent, interpretable, and understandable for individuals who may interact with the systems
  • Deliver projects while working with multiple and diverse teams
  • Maintain data definitions, adhere to data quality rules, and maintain data lineage
  • Maintain a data dictionary
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ree, preferably in a technical field or data-driven area of study, and three years of relevant data science-related experience
  • Strong background in machine learning, natural language processing, and data analysis
  • Excellent communication skills to bridge the gap between technical and non-technical teams
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ience with healthcare data (clinical, claims, etc.) is highly desirable
  • Experience in analytical and problem-solving and exposure to large volume data systems is preferred
